Job Description
AI Summary
• Develop and validate complex system dynamics models in MATLAB/Simulink for U.S. Navy submarine logistics and support networks, with mentorship from experienced engineers.
• Process real-world data and create post-processing utilities to visualize simulation results and compare them against actual operational data.
• Learn and implement MATLAB/Simulink coding best practices while reviewing and improving existing code provided by the team.
• Must be pursuing a Bachelor's or Master's degree in Mechanical Engineering or related field with minimum 3.0 GPA and ability to obtain Secret level security clearance (U.S. citizenship required).
• Internship at Johns Hopkins Applied Physics Laboratory, a world-class defense and technology organization offering collaborative environment and professional development opportunities.
